Karen Gillan says “there was full tears” after reading Guardians of the Galaxy Vol.3 script

July 13, 2021 by Liam Waddington

While production on Guardians of the Galaxy Vol.3 isn’t scheduled to begin production until later this year, one of the stars of the Marvel Cinematic Universe has confirmed that she has read the script and offered her thoughts on the third film.

In an interview with Collider to promote her upcoming Netflix film Gunpowder Milkshake, Karen Gillan, who has played Nebula in both Guardians films as well as Avengers: Infinity War and Avengers: Endgame, stated that she believes Vol.3 is writer/director James Gunn’s strongest work yet in the MCU.

“I read that script with Pom Klementieff, who plays Mantis. We read it together and we both cried and laughed, but there was full tears. It’s incredible, I think it’s James’ strongest work yet with the Guardians and it’s just brilliant. It’s brilliant and it’s emotional and it’s funny and it’s all of those things that you want,” Gillan said.

Although the third Guardians of the Galaxy film is currently scheduled to release in 2023 as a result of the pandemic and director James Gunn’s firing by Disney, Gillan is set to reprise her role in the fourth instalment of the Thor franchise, Thor: Love and Thunder, alongside Chris Pratt, Pom Klementieff, Dave Bautista, and Sean Gunn – which is scheduled for a May 6th 2022 release.

While plot details for Vol.3 are being kept under wraps, it is safe to assume that all of the Guardians will be returning including Chris Pratt as Star-Lord, Dave Bautista as Drax, Vin Diesel as Groot, Bradley Cooper as Rocket Raccoon, Pom Klementieff as Mantis, Sean Gunn as Kraglin and Rocket Raccoon, and Karen Gillan as Nebula.

Guardians of the Galaxy Vol. 3 is set for release on May 5th 2023.
